Maintenance:
- Vacuuming or sweeping any loose crumbs, dust, or debris from the tiles when necessary
- Hose off or damp mop the floor tiles with a mild soap and water mixture for tough or caked on dirt and/or stains.

Installation:
Nitro Tiles are easy to install. Installation of these floor tiles typically includes:- Clean your sub floor so that it is free of all dirt, dust, grease, or other foreign material.
- When installing the Grid-Loc tiles, we recommend starting in the front left corner of the room and working your way out from there
- Make sure the female side (loops) of the tile is facing away from the wall
- When you come up to a wall or object, don’t worry. Just measure the area and cut the tiles with a sharp utility knife and put the trimmed tiles into place.
- When trimming the tiles into place, make sure you leave about a 3/4” space between the tiles and the wall or obstruction.
- Once the tiles are in place, you can then snap in the edge pieces, if you purchased them.
